A global consulting firm in the UK is seeking a highly skilled Transfer Pricing Senior Manager to join their team. This role involves leading transfer pricing documentation for international clients and managing complex projects that require collaboration with diverse professionals.
Ideal candidates will thrive in multicultural settings and demonstrate expertise in international tax strategies. The firm promotes continuous development and offers the opportunity to work on impactful projects within a supportive environment.
